Weather in May

Weather in May is characterized by a substantial increase in temperature, signalling the onset of summer. As the conditions become dry, trails and national parks come alive with outdoor enthusiasts. Increased daylight hours lead to longer, adventurous days and pleasant evenings backed with vivid sunsets. It is the perfect time for sky gazing, with clearer skies providing incredible views of celestial bodies.

Temperature

As May arrives, Sedona's weather shows a minor increase in high-temperatures, edging from April's comfortable 63.1°F (17.3°C) to a pleasant 70.2°F (21.2°C). In May, the recorded average low-temperature, of 45.3°F (7.4°C), exhibits a significant fall from the daytime highs.

Humidity

The average relative humidity in May is 32%.

Rainfall

In Sedona, in May, during 4.6 rainfall days, 0.35" (9mm) of precipitation is typically accumulated. Throughout the year, there are 86 rainfall days, and 11.65" (296mm) of precipitation is accumulated.

Snowfall

May through October are months without snowfall in Sedona.

Daylight

The average length of the day in May in Sedona is 14h and 1min.
On the first day of May in Sedona, Arizona, sunrise is at 5:35 am and sunset at 7:12 pm. On the last day of the month, sunrise is at 5:14 am and sunset at 7:35 pm MST.

Sunshine

The average sunshine in May is 11.8h.

UV index

The average daily maximum UV index in May in Sedona is 5. A UV Index reading of 3 to 5 represents a medium health hazard from unsafe exposure to UV radiation for average individuals.
Note: An average maximum UV index of 5 in May leads to these recommendations:
Exercise caution. Those with pale skin may experience burns in less than half an hour. Direct Sun exposure should be minimized especially during midday when radiation is most intense. Outfit yourself in sun-safe attire, like long sleeves, pants, a hat, and UV-blocking sunglasses.
